Former India opener Shikhar Dhawan opens Residential Elite Cricket Academy in Pathankot

Former India opener Shikhar Dhawan has opened Da One Sports’ first Residential Elite Cricket Academy in Pathankot. The academy, which has been established at Sandeepni Gurukul, aims to give young cricketers with a structured atmosphere that mixes high-quality cricket training with formal education.

Da One Sports, founded by Dhawan, aims to provide long-term growth opportunities for young athletes rather than short-term training facilities. The residential academy’s launch objective is to provide a holistic approach that combines expert coaching, academics, and residential facilities under one roof. Located in Pathankot, the academy aims to tap into the region’s often-overlooked talent pool while also ensuring students’ academic stability.

The Residential Elite Cricket Academy was created as a long-term development initiative for young players. The facility will provide professional coaching, structured academic support, and a safe living environment for students to train.

Shikhar Dhawan announced the project, emphasising the significance of education in addition to sports.

“I have always believed that for a child’s overall growth, education and sport must go hand in hand. With our residential elite cricket academy at Sandeepni Gurukul, we are creating a structured and secure environment where young players can dream big, train professionally, and grow with confidence. If this platform can help create even one future India player or the next Shikhar Dhawan, it will be a proud moment for all of us. More importantly, I hope this initiative inspires many more kids to pick up sports and believe in themselves,” he said in a statement.

Furthermore, Anshita Gupta, Group CEO of Da One Sports, said the academy is the foundation of the organisation’s philosophy.

“This residential academy reflects the very foundation of Da One, building pathways, not just facilities. We aim to create an environment where education and high-performance sport coexist seamlessly. Sandeepni Gurukul and Pathankot gives us access to an untapped talent base and the opportunity to offer a structured, trusted ecosystem for young athletes. We firmly believe that education and sport, when nurtured together, can unlock extraordinary potential,” she said.

Founder Chairman of Sandeepni Gurukul, Sahil Mahajan, opened up about the significance of the collaboration.

“We aspire to build the biggest cricket centre in Pathankot, where students from across the region can come to train at a professional level while managing their studies seamlessly. As an educational institution, our focus has always been on offering the best of both sports and academics, and this partnership with Da One Sports further strengthens that belief,” he quipped.
